WebAccording to the remainder theorem, when a polynomial p(x) (whose degree is greater than or equal to 1) is divided by a linear polynomial x - a, the remainder is given by r = p(a). i.e., to find the remainder, follow the steps below:. Find the zero of the linear polynomial by setting it to zero. i.e., x - a = 0 ⇒ x = a.; Then just substitute it in the given polynomial.
